Tim Bush

Tim Bush, Tri-City entrepreneur began opening car washes in the area, and also in Walla Walla in 2007. His businesses have provided much needed, quality operations in Richland, West Richland, Kennewick, and Pasco. The Bush car washes have provided cleaning for our law enforcement vehicles and the Bush family has held strong relationships with the communities they serve. Their product has provided superior service, with attention to detail and well-maintained equipment. Tim Bush car washes offer a monthly payment program that allows the customer unlimited exterior washes. Just last year, however, the car wash facilities started by the Bush family sold to Mister Car Wash.

Mister Car Wash

The following locations are part of the package sale to Mister Car Wash: The properties at Aaron Dr. in Richland, Burden Blvd. in Pasco, Kennedy Dr. in West Richland, W. Court in Pasco, and the properties on Columbia Dr. and W. Okanogan Pl. in Kennewick. The transfer has taken place and new signage is being established at the newly acquired Mister Car Washes across the Tri-Cities. Mister Car Wash promises to bring experience to the local car wash service. Based in Tucson, Arizona, Mister Car Wash is the largest car wash company in the U.S. Their website ensures that the Bush tradition of community connection and excellent patron service will continue under the new company.

Spanky’s

In 2016, successful entrepreneurs Craig and Suzanne Garrison of Yakima opened a new car wash at 2544 Queensgate Drive. The couple own two car washes in Yakima but assessed a need in the South Richland neighborhood and used local builders, Siefken & Sons to construct the new building. Their business lies adjacent to Sterling’s and near Fujiyama’s. Competition is strong in the Tri-Cities, but it should be noted that the original Spanky’s Car Wash & Detail Center in Yakima was voted “Yakima’s Best Car Wash” for more than eight years running. Spanky’s offers a monthly billing under $25.00 that entitles the customer to unlimited washes. What’s unique about the product Spanky’s offers is the washing process. There are no cloths or brushes that sometimes leave swirls on a car; their wash consists of only soap, soft (hot) water, and pressure. A quick, hand wipe-off ensures your car leaves sparkling clean!

Friends

In the past two years another car wash that is locally owned opened at 1225 Guyer in Richland, tucked behind the Golden Palace restaurant off George Washington Way. Like both the Mister Car Washes and Spanky’s, Friends offers an unlimited car wash package for a comparable price. This car wash has excellent reviews on-line and many customers who comment that Friends pays close attention to customer service.
